PETALING JAYA: Two people were hurt after their car plunged into a 12-metre-deep sewer under construction in Jalan Universiti, Section 17, today.
Damansara Rescue and Fire Department station chief Ramli Harun said they received a distress call at 2pm and sent a fire engine there, Star Online reported.
Firemen found a Toyota Vios had plunged into a sewer and managed to rescue the two inside after about an hour.
Both victims were sent to the Universiti Malaya Medical Centre for treatment for multiple injuries.
A crane was used to extricate the car from the sewer.
